src.nth.io/

summaryrefslogtreecommitdiff
path: root/iperf3/server/tasks/main.yaml
diff options
context:
space:
mode:
Diffstat (limited to 'iperf3/server/tasks/main.yaml')
-rw-r--r--iperf3/server/tasks/main.yaml17
1 files changed, 17 insertions, 0 deletions
diff --git a/iperf3/server/tasks/main.yaml b/iperf3/server/tasks/main.yaml
new file mode 100644
index 0000000..7f89b07
--- /dev/null
+++ b/iperf3/server/tasks/main.yaml
@@ -0,0 +1,17 @@
+---
+
+- name: apt install iperf3
+ become: yes
+ apt: name="iperf3"
+
+- name: install iperf3 service
+ become: yes
+ copy:
+ src: "iperf3.service"
+ dest: "/lib/systemd/system/iperf3.service"
+ mode: "0644"
+ notify: restart iperf3
+
+- name: ensure iperf3 is started
+ become: yes
+ systemd: service="iperf3.service" enabled="yes" state="started" daemon_reload="yes"